Output 1004813c61dbc71de05c04a5da872daf4f3e09a2d03b74a7b2e20cfc18cfcd21:2

value
2529778
script pubkey
OP_0 OP_PUSHBYTES_32 dbe3ac55ad63222884d89ce249294405b0d1b892598b0bc57ed81a9785ce661e
address
bc1qm036c4ddvv3z3pxcnn3yj22yqkcdrwyjtx9sh3t7mqdf0pwwvc0q3p9acs
transaction
1004813c61dbc71de05c04a5da872daf4f3e09a2d03b74a7b2e20cfc18cfcd21
spent
true